Book summary


During the final months of World War II, on an isolated hilltop in the deserts of New Mexico, top-level government scientists are at work on the Manhattan Project. When a security officer for the Project turns up dead under mysterious circumstances, army intelligence officer Michael Connolly arrives to investigate. Could the dead man have leaked valuable information that would jeopardize the Project?

Book desription: NY: Broadway Books, 1997. An Unread Copy, In a clear protective Brodart mylar cover. This is the author's first novel and winner of the Edgar Award. The time is Spring, 1945 and the place is Los Alamos where work on the first atomic bomb is nearing completion. All is going as well as expected until a security expert is murdered. Joseph Kanon combines the elements of an espionage thriller and a historical novel and writes about it so convincingly that you swear he was at Los Alamos in 1945.. First Edition- First Printing.
